10 Tópicos mais importantes para o Início da Carreira de Desenvolvedor!
- #Programação para Internet
- #HTML
- #JavaScript
A carreira de desenvolvedor é uma jornada emocionante, repleta de oportunidades para aprender, crescer e criar um impacto significativo na indústria de tecnologia. No entanto, os primeiros passos podem ser desafiadores e, por vezes, confusos. Neste artigo, exploraremos as 10 coisas mais importantes que você precisa considerar ao iniciar sua carreira de desenvolvedor com sucesso. Vamos abordar os aspectos essenciais, desde a escolha das linguagens de programação até a construção de um portfólio impressionante e a busca de oportunidades.
**1. Escolhendo sua Linguagem de Programação**
A primeira decisão importante ao iniciar uma carreira de desenvolvedor é escolher a linguagem de programação com a qual você deseja trabalhar. Existem muitas opções disponíveis, como JavaScript, Python, Java, Ruby e muitas outras. A escolha dependerá de seus interesses e objetivos.
**2. Aprender e Praticar**
Uma vez escolhida a linguagem, o próximo passo é aprender e praticar. Dedique tempo diariamente para estudar e praticar codificação. A prática constante é a chave para aprimorar suas habilidades.
**3. Construindo um Portfólio**
Enquanto estuda e pratica, comece a construir um portfólio de projetos. Isso mostrará aos potenciais empregadores o seu nível de habilidade e o tipo de trabalho que você é capaz de realizar.
**4. Networking e Comunidades**
Participar de comunidades de desenvolvedores e redes profissionais é essencial. Plataformas como o GitHub, Stack Overflow e LinkedIn são ótimos lugares para se conectar com outros desenvolvedores.
**5. Buscando Oportunidades**
Quando se sentir confiante em suas habilidades e tiver um portfólio sólido, comece a procurar oportunidades de trabalho. Envie seu currículo para empresas de tecnologia, use sites de busca de empregos e esteja aberto a estágios e projetos freelance para ganhar experiência.
**6. Mentoria e Aprendizado Contínuo**
Encontrar um mentor experiente pode acelerar significativamente seu crescimento profissional. E, à medida que avança em sua carreira, nunca pare de aprender.
**7. Resolução de Problemas**
A habilidade de resolver problemas é essencial para um desenvolvedor. Pratique a resolução de problemas de programação para melhorar suas habilidades de solução de problemas.
**8. Compreendendo os Fundamentos**
Entender os conceitos fundamentais da programação, como estruturas de dados, algoritmos e paradigmas de programação, é crucial para se tornar um desenvolvedor habilidoso.
**9. Teste e Depuração**
Aprenda a escrever testes e depurar seu código de forma eficaz. Isso é essencial para criar software de alta qualidade.
**10. Desenvolvimento Ágil e Colaboração**
Entenda os princípios do desenvolvimento ágil e saiba como colaborar eficazmente em equipes de desenvolvimento. A capacidade de trabalhar em conjunto é fundamental no mundo profissional.
Ao considerar esses 10 aspectos essenciais, você estará construindo os alicerces do seu sucesso como desenvolvedor. Lembre-se de que a carreira de desenvolvedor é uma jornada contínua de aprendizado e crescimento, então mantenha-se motivado e comprometido com seu objetivo de se tornar um desenvolvedor de destaque. Com dedicação e paixão, você pode alcançar grandes conquistas na indústria de tecnologia.